Initial salary = $50,000 .
Rate of raise = 5% each year.
Therefore, each next year salary would be 105% that is 1.05 times.
5% of 50,000 = 0.05 × 50000 = 2500.
Therefore raise is $2500 each year.
According to geometric sequence first term 50000 and common ratio 1.05.
Applying geometric sequence formula
1)
2) In order to find salary in 5 years we need to plug n=5, we get
= 50000(1.21550625)
<h3>=$60775.3125.</h3>
3) In order to find the total salary in 10 years we need to apply sum of 10 terms formula of a geometric sequence.
Plugging n=10, a = 50000 and r= 1.05.
= 628894.62678.
<h3>Therefore , you will have earned $ 628894.62678 in total salary by the end of your 10th year.</h3>
Answer:
the x intercept is -4
Step-by-step explanation:
to find the x intercept, set y = 0 and solve for x
y = 5x+20
0 = 5x+20
subtract 20 from each side
-20 = 5x +20 -20
-20 = 5x
divide each side by 5
-20/5 = 5x/5
-4 =x
